Output d3af98a035c724a46535209562b69248aef175b36449265956f5ad5a8bbe15ea:1

value
88883
script pubkey
OP_0 OP_PUSHBYTES_20 8e35e8c3def94abd85dab3be565dc8471d4fda99
address
bc1q3c673s77l99tmpw6kwl9vhwgguw5lk5e0lva39
transaction
d3af98a035c724a46535209562b69248aef175b36449265956f5ad5a8bbe15ea
spent
true